Reviews the quality of instructions and guidance provided to agents. Good implementation is clear, handles edge cases, and produces reliable results.

A comprehensive, highly actionable SEO skill with excellent code examples, a validated audit workflow, and a clearly signaled reference split for structured data. Its main weakness is conciseness: extensive guideline bullets restate well-known SEO basics and much detailed content remains inline rather than progressively disclosed.

Suggestions

Trim or collapse the per-section "guidelines" bullet lists that restate basics Claude already knows (e.g., "Use hyphens, not underscores", "Lowercase only", "Fix broken links promptly"), keeping only the non-obvious calibration notes.

Move the Mobile SEO and International SEO reference blocks into separate files under references/ and link to them from SKILL.md, mirroring the existing STRUCTURED-DATA.md split, to reduce inline bulk.

Consider consolidating the near-identical title/meta-description "linting proxy" caveats into one statement rather than repeating the framing in each section.
